From: Informing investment in health workforce in Bangladesh: a health labour market analysis
Type of institution | Degree and length | 2010 | 2016 | 2020 |
---|---|---|---|---|
Medical colleges | Bachelor, 5 years | 62 | 105 | 113 |
Dental colleges | Bachelor, 5 years, | 17 | 35 | 35 |
Nursing colleges | Bachelor, 4 years | 30 | 64 | 174 |
Nursing institutes (nursing and midwifery) | Diploma, 3 years | 57 | 157 | 223 |
Sub-Assistant Community Medical Officer (SACMO)Training Schools | Diploma, 3 years | 47 | 208 | 209 |
Institutes of health technology (offering Diploma in Medical Technology-pharmacy) | Diploma, 3 years | 61 (35) | 105 (51) | 110 (54) |
No. of universities offering bachelor’s degree in pharmacy | Bachelor, 4–5 years | 32 | 36 | 41 |
Total | 306 | 710 | 905 |
